Output 61fb08f18b8acb65e2f06123d9ea84d027bddb45b29b24fdde99b0f314863ed2:31

value
10618040
script pubkey
OP_0 OP_PUSHBYTES_20 e51c7328a39919523f6ca2562779cd03aadb7af3
address
ltc1qu5w8x29rnyv4y0mv5ftzw7wdqw4dk7hn783q5d
transaction
61fb08f18b8acb65e2f06123d9ea84d027bddb45b29b24fdde99b0f314863ed2
spent
true